Megaways engines appear frequently in the new additions, and I have always thought this mechanic matches the Australian appetite for volatility perfectly. The dynamic reel modifier means every spin delivers a different number of ways to win, sometimes exceeding 100,000 combinations. I discovered several titles pushing this concept further with dual-reaction systems where winning symbols disappear and new ones cascade down, creating chain reactions from a single stake. The potential for massive multipliers stacking during these sequences is genuinely thrilling.
The classic Hold & Win format has gotten significant upgrades in the new N1Bet library. I played through iterations where sticky symbols carry multipliers, expand to fill entire reels, or trigger respins that reset with every new symbol landing. Some versions now include jackpot tiers within the feature itself, adding a meta-layer of anticipation. These enhancements preserve a familiar mechanic feeling fresh, and I noticed my session times extending naturally because the feature triggers felt more strategic and rewarding than older implementations.
